North Western Railway is operating a special Maha Kumbh Mela train, 09453/09454, between Sabarmati and Varanasi on February 21st and 22nd, 2025. Train 09453 departs Sabarmati at 11:00 AM on February 21st, 2025, arriving in Varanasi at 4:00 PM on February 22nd, 2025. Train 09454 departs Varanasi at 7:30 PM... on February 22nd, 2025, arriving in Sabarmati at 00:30 AM on February 24th, 2025. The train will stop at Mehsana, Palanpur, Abu Road, Pindwara, Falna, Rani, Marwar Jn., Beawar, Ajmer, Kishangarh, Jaipur, Bandikui, Bharatpur, Agra Fort, Tundla, Etawah, Govindpuri, Fatehpur, Prayagraj (via Prayagraj Rambag), and Gyanpur Road. The train consists of 1 AC First Class, 5 AC Third Class, 14 Second Class Sleeper, 2 General Class, and 2 Guard compartments, totaling 24 coaches.

To manage increased passenger traffic during the Anganewadi Festival 2025, additional special trains will run between Sawantwadi Road and Lokmanya Tilak (T). Train 01134 departs Sawantwadi Road at 6 PM on February 23rd, 2025, arriving at Lokmanya Tilak (T) at 6:25 AM on February 24th. Train 01133 departs Lokmanya Tilak (T)... at 8:20 AM on February 24th, 2025, arriving at Sawantwadi Road at 7 PM the same day. The trains will stop at Kudal, Sindhudurg, Kankavali, Vaibhavwadi Road, Rajapur Road, Vilavade, Adavali, Ratnagiri, Sangameshwar Road, Chiplun, Khed, Mangaon, Roha, Pen, Panvel, and Thane. The train consists of 20 LHB coaches (1 2-tier AC, 3 3-tier AC, 2 3-tier AC Economy, 8 Sleeper, 4 General, 1 Generator, 1 SLR). Bookings for Train 01134 open on February 9th, 2025.

The Barmer-Baruni-Barmer Maha Kumbh Mela Special Train (04811/04812) will operate its second trip on Friday. Departing Barmer at 5:30 PM, it will reach Prayagraj at 7:05 PM the next day and Baruni at 9:00 AM on the third day. The return journey (04812) starts from Baruni at 11:00 PM on February... 9th, arriving in Barmer at 1:00 PM on the third day. The train consists of 2 AC 2-tier, 5 AC 3-tier, 11 Sleeper class, 4 General, and 2 Guard compartments. Halts are planned at Balotra, Samadari, Jodhpur, Merta Road, Degana, Makrana, Kuchaman City, Phulera, Jaipur, Gandhinagar Jaipur, Bandikui, Bharatpur, Agra Fort, Tundla, Etawah, Govindpuri, Fatehpur, Prayagraj, Mirzapur, Pandit Deendayal Upadhyaya, Buxar, Ara, Danapur, Patliputra, and Hajipur stations.

The Korba-Trivandrum-Korba Express will be cancelled for 10 days (February 10-19) due to the construction of a third railway line at Khammam station in the Secunderabad railway division. Train No. 22648 (Trivandrum-Korba Express) will be cancelled on February 10, 13, and 17, while Train No. 22647 (Korba-Trivandrum Express) will be cancelled... on February 12, 15, and 19. Construction work in the Kazipet-Vijayawada section (February 10-20) and modernization work at Sambalpur station (February 5-April 30) are also causing disruptions. Several trains, including those on the Bhubaneswar-Mumbai, Puri-Mumbai, Puri-Jodhpur, Puri-Lalgarh, and Visakhapatnam-Amritsar routes, will be diverted via Sarla Junction-Sambalpur City during the Sambalpur station work.
